1,3-di(thiophen-2-yl)propane-1,3-dione

Description:
1,3-Di(thiophen-2-yl)propane-1,3-dione, with the CAS number 1138-14-3, is an organic compound characterized by its unique structure featuring two thiophene rings attached to a propane backbone with diketone functional groups. This compound exhibits notable properties such as strong electron-accepting capabilities due to the presence of the carbonyl groups, which can participate in various chemical reactions, including nucleophilic additions. The thiophene rings contribute to its aromatic character, enhancing its stability and potential for π-π stacking interactions. Additionally, this compound may display interesting optical properties, making it a candidate for applications in organic electronics, such as organic photovoltaics and light-emitting diodes. Its solubility in organic solvents and ability to form thin films further expand its utility in material science. Overall, 1,3-di(thiophen-2-yl)propane-1,3-dione is a versatile compound with significant implications in both synthetic chemistry and advanced material applications.
Formula:C11H8O2S2
InChI:InChI=1/C11H8O2S2/c12-8(10-3-1-5-14-10)7-9(13)11-4-2-6-15-11/h1-6H,7H2
SMILES:c1cc(C(=O)CC(=O)c2cccs2)sc1
